On 2-25-04 I was called by CPI, offered 200.00 in gasoline coupons and agreed to examine the Wellnet wellness Plan, I answered no to all other questions. The next Day I called CPI to cancel the deal. Concerned that this was a scam I called CPI again in mid march to re-cancel.
On April 14 I dicovered that they had created a draft (did not use the check # I provided) and withdrew 139.00 from my account. My bank advised me to contact them directly and request a refund. Upon calling CPI, they said the charge was for a Talk Unlimited phone plan, and a check authorization form would be sent, since they could not credit my account.
After I found the usacomplaints.com site, I have learned what a fool I have been, and that the prospects of a refund are not good (zipp). After spending hours searching the web I have found First American Investments based in Pompano Beach, Florida which has the same 1800 number as Utalk, wellnet, CPI, and is linked with AM Values, American Values and Connect2.
First American (www.cnaworks.com) lists its services as providing advertising, virtual office packages, telephone answering and mail forwarding within the US and offshore. They also promise to protect thier clients identity and corporate structure. First American also lists their corporate headquarters in greece.
